Access#
To use object storage authorized users need to configure EC2 access keys under the S3 protocol.
Create an ES2 Access Key#
- In the Control Panel go to the “Object storage” / “Access” section. 
- By default, ES2 keys are not created. To access using a software client under the S3 protocol it is necessary to create ES2 keys by clicking “Create ES2 keys”. 
- An Access key and a Secret key will be generated that can be copied to a client program (for example, S3 Browser, AWS, Cyberduck) for access to the containers under the S3 protocol. 
- Depending on the region of the container’s location specify the proper access address. Current access addresses are posted under “Object storage” / “Access” in the account.
